Summary: Reads Like a Childrens' Book
Comment: I can't stand it when I read a book that sounds like it's for a 5 year old. The way the text is written insults my intelligence. Virtually no references are provided to support the claims and recommendations that the authors make. I suggest checking out Kilmer McCully's books for a more informative reading session.

Summary: Easy - And it works!!
Comment: I had very bad eating habits and in March of this year participated in a cholesterol screening at work. I found out that my cholesterol readings put me in the "high-risk" category for heart disease. So I decided I would attempt to make a change in the way I eat. I spent a short time researching on the internet when I ran across this book. After reading the reviews, I decided to give it a shot. I found the book to be very well written, easy to understand and it seemed to make a lot of sense. Plus the authors appeared credible. I began to monitor my intake of "bad" fat, sticking to the "high-risk" recommendation of 10 grams of "bad" fat/day. Two months later I had my cholesterol checked again. My improvement was evident. I went from: Overall Cholesterol: 229 to 210 LDL (Lousy Cholesterol): 176 to 150 HDL (Healthy Cholesterol - higher is better): 26 to 39 Ratio (Under 4.5 considered healthy): 8.8 to 5.4 Weight: 224lbs. to 211lbs.

This in only 2 months! If I keep this up who knows????????????? Buy the book if you are concerned about your cholesterol and heart disease. It's cheap and it makes sense.
